Chick-Fil-A Oaks Mall
Across the available record, Chick-Fil-A Oaks Mall has eight inspections on file, the first dated 2022. The most recent visit was on Feb 9, 2026. When a facility lands in medium risk territory, it usually means a mixed inspection result.
Things are looking better lately, with recent visits averaging around three violations compared to roughly six violations earlier on.
“Nonfood-contact surface soiled with grease” accounts for the largest share of issues, appearing five times across the record.
The city-wide average sits at 75, which Chick-Fil-A Oaks Mall's 70 doesn't quite reach. The inspection history reads as standard for a restaurant of this size.
